UNO Card Game Review: A Classic Game for All Ages
UNO is a classic card game that has been around for decades. It is a game that is easy to learn and can be played by people of all ages. The game has been so popular that it has spawned many spinoff games, including UNO All Wild! and a digital version of the game. In this review, we will take a look at the pros and cons of the game.
Pros
Easy to Learn: One of the biggest advantages of UNO is that it is easy to learn. The game has simple rules that can be explained in a matter of minutes. This makes it a great game for children and adults who are new to card games.
Affordable: Another advantage of UNO is that it is an affordable game. The game is widely available and can be purchased for a low price. This makes it a great game for families who are looking for a fun activity that won't break the bank.
Great for Travel: UNO is a great game to take on the go. The game is small and portable, making it easy to pack in a bag or suitcase. This makes it a great game to play while on vacation or during a long car ride.
Fun for All Ages: UNO is a game that can be enjoyed by people of all ages. The game is simple enough for children to play, but also has enough strategy to keep adults engaged.
Digital Version Available: For those who prefer to play games on their electronic devices, a digital version of UNO is available. The digital version of the game is faithful to the original and can be played with friends or against the computer.
Cons
Luck-Based: One of the biggest disadvantages of UNO is that it is a luck-based game. The game relies heavily on chance, which can be frustrating for players who prefer games that require more skill.
Too Easy: Another disadvantage of UNO is that it can be too easy for some players. The game is simple and straightforward, which can make it feel repetitive after a while.
Limited Strategy: UNO is a game that has limited strategy. While there are some decisions that players can make, the game is largely based on luck. This can make the game feel less engaging for players who prefer games that require more strategy.
Not for Everyone: While UNO is a game that can be enjoyed by people of all ages, it is not for everyone. Some players may find the game too simple or too luck-based for their tastes.
